Transaction aed83e12c63aca71678b81807b069307aaa2433b77021300c33a9de0e5ba4171

4 Input
1 Outputs
  • aed83e12c63aca71678b81807b069307aaa2433b77021300c33a9de0e5ba4171:0
  • value  15984864
    address  3HBSHEEdLPMRSk2WER4LGset9BttquTLjM